Illegal mining: the problem and possible solutions ...

Illegal mining: the problem and possible solutions ...

 · Illegal mining: the problem and possible solutions. 24 May 2016 20:30. The South African Human Rights Commission estimates that there are between 8000 and 30 000 illegal miners operating in South Africa. According to the Chamber of Mines, roughly between 5% and 10% of South Africa's annual gold production stems from illegal mining.

Research On Illegal Gold Mining

Research On Illegal Gold Mining

Research On Illegal Gold Mining. Jan 01, 2016 Illegal mining is a poverty driven activity that is practiced in most developing countries where there is a poorly edued population and few employment opportunities (Yaro, 2010, Bagyina, 2012). Globally, an estimated 20 million people engage in illegal mining with nearly one quarter of the world's gold output originating from it (Hilson, 2001 ...
